Core Scientific Stock Up 2.7%

The firm has a fifty day moving average of $13.80 and a 200-day moving average of $11.00. The firm has a market cap of $4.43 billion, a P/E ratio of -25.88 and a beta of 6.60.

Core Scientific (NASDAQ:CORZ - Get Free Report) last issued its earnings results on Friday, August 8th. The company reported ($0.04) ear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ping analysts' consensus estimates of ($0.07) by $0.03. The company had revenue of $78.63 million for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$82.09 million. The business's quarterly revenue was down 44.3% compared to the same quarter last year. Sell-side analysts anticipate that Core Scientific, Inc. will post 0.52 EPS for the current year.

Core Scientific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Core Scientific, Inc provides digital asset mining services in North America. It operates through two segments, Mining and Hosting. The company offers blockchain infrastructure, software solutions, and services; and operates data center mining facilities. It also mines digital assets for its own account; and provides hosting services for other large bitcoin miners, which include deployment, monitoring, trouble shooting, optimization, and maintenance of its customers' digital asset mining equipment.
